Ticket: PAIRWISE-2241 — Expired credentials blocking GC telemetry

The Pairwise matching service has been showing 900ms GC pauses, but the heap telemetry exporter stopped reporting after its credentials expired last week. Without the exporter we can't confirm whether the old-gen pressure fix helped. A replacement key has been issued; it appears on the next line.

gateway credential: kto23_LX9A4ys6i4nzHtpOLNLodKK

## Runbook: Gaugepile Sidecar — Release Checklist

Heads up: the sidecar ships with every app pod, so a bad config fans out fast. Before cutting a release, confirm the flush interval hasn't drifted from what the Tallyhouse aggregator expects, or you'll see sawtooth gaps in dashboards. Rollbacks are cheap — just repin the image tag. Canary one node pool first, watch for ten minutes, then proceed. The values to verify against are these.

config for bagep-yafof:
quenath:
  pin: 8584
  metrics_host: metrics.quenath.tolvaqsys.internal
  tenant: pelath
  seal: seal_ed102645

Hey — handover for the audit-log viewer (Ledgerlens) while I'm out.

It's mostly stable. The one fiddly bit is the retention and pagination setup; the defaults in the repo README are out of date, so ignore those. Query timeouts were bumped last month after the Fennick incident. The values actually running in production right now are these.

service settings:
[silwyn]
host = silwyn.crelvogrid.internal
user = silwyn_svc
database = silwyn_prod